The Role of Color in Communicating Wins
Color psychology has long been used in marketing and product design, and Spadegaming leans heavily on this in its s-lot games. Wins are often accompanied by gold or radiant hues, signaling prosperity and triumph. Secondary wins might feature cooler tones like blues or greens, which convey steadiness and satisfaction without overwhelming the player.
This hierarchy of colors establishes an intuitive system. Even without reading numbers or payout amounts, a player can quickly recognize whether they have landed a minor win or a major jackpot simply through the richness of the color palette.
Animation as a Narrative of Victory
Static visuals rarely capture emotion. Spadegaming understands this, and so animations are carefully crafted to dramatize every win. When reels align with a rewarding combination, symbols may shimmer, expand, or burst into particle effects. Larger wins trigger more elaborate sequences, such as cascading fireworks or glowing frames that wrap around the reels.
These animations serve a dual purpose. First, they heighten excitement in the moment. Second, they create a memory imprint, making players recall not only that they won but also how spectacularly the win was presented. In a highly competitive s-lot market, these memorable sequences set Spadegaming apart.
Synchronization of Visuals with Sound
It is impossible to separate visuals from their auditory counterparts. Spadegaming’s approach often integrates visuals with sound in a synchronized rhythm. For instance, a win may start with a visual flash of symbols followed by ascending tones, and then culminate with a burst of light timed exactly to a cymbal crash.
This cross-sensory approach intensifies the win effect. The visuals validate the sounds, while the sounds energize the visuals, creating an immersive loop that convinces the brain the moment is more impactful than the payout alone might suggest.
Cultural Storytelling in Win Signals
Spadegaming’s portfolio often features games inspired by Asian legends, mythology, and folklore. The win visuals in these games frequently borrow from cultural symbols that already carry meaning. A dragon wrapping around the reels when a win is triggered signals strength and fortune. Lanterns lighting up the screen during a payout create a sense of celebration rooted in traditional festivals.
By linking wins to cultural cues, Spadegaming not only communicates victory but also connects players to familiar narratives. This cultural grounding makes the wins feel personal and contextually significant rather than abstract.
Progression and Scaling of Win Visuals
One of the clever strategies Spadegaming employs is scaling win visuals depending on the magnitude of the payout. Small wins might be shown with subtle highlights and minimal animations. Medium wins may introduce more elaborate flashes and screen-wide overlays. Massive wins, on the other hand, are treated like cinematic events, with extended animations, sweeping camera effects, and celebratory motifs that engulf the entire playfield.
This scaling ensures that players do not grow desensitized to win visuals. The hierarchy maintains excitement across all tiers, preserving anticipation for the biggest rewards.
Reinforcing Multipliers Through Visual Drama
Multipliers have become a cornerstone of modern selot design, and Spadegaming uses visuals to make these mechanics more thrilling. When a multiplier is applied, the screen may glow with pulsating colors, and the multiplier itself might be animated as if growing larger in size or power. The moment is visualized as a transformation rather than just a number increase.
This dramatization of multipliers taps into a player’s psychology, making them perceive the outcome as more significant and rewarding. It is not just mathematics at work but a story of power unfolding before their eyes.
Visual Anticipation of Wins
Another subtle but highly effective technique is anticipation-building through visuals. Spadegaming games often slow down reel spins, flash potential winning symbols, or add glowing effects to near misses. While not always resulting in a win, these signals keep players’ attention locked and their excitement elevated.
This form of suspense is critical for engagement. It creates a rhythm in gameplay where players are not just reacting to outcomes but actively waiting for them with heightened emotional investment.
